What is The British-American Project C/O Joshua J Zarlenga?
The British-American Project C/O Joshua J Zarlenga is a nonprofit organization based in Canfield, Ohio, with the address 6603 Summit Drive. Its primary mission is to foster education and understanding between members from the United States and the United Kingdom. The organization achieves this by planning and conducting an annual convention, where delegates engage in fellowship, develop a heightened sense of responsibility towards their societies, and explore common approaches to mutual interests. Outside speakers and facilitators are also incorporated into the convention to enrich the discussions and learning experiences.

Is The British-American Project C/O Joshua J Zarlenga legitimate?
The British-American Project C/O Joshua J Zarlenga is a legitimate nonprofit organization registered as a 501(c)(3) entity. The British-American Project C/O Joshua J Zarlenga submitted a form 990, which is a tax form used by tax-exempt organizations in the U.S., indicating its operational transparency and adherence to regulatory requirements. Donations to this organization are tax deductible.

What is the mission statement of The British-American Project C/O Joshua J Zarlenga?
The mission of The British-American Project is to foster fellowship between individuals from the United States and the United Kingdom. It achieves this by encouraging the formation of lasting relationships among its participants. The project aims to inspire a heightened sense of responsibility towards their respective societies among the participants. Furthermore, it strives to develop common approaches to issues of mutual interest and provides a challenging and cooperative environment for participants to explore their personal goals.
